Below is a list of the species in Santa Cruz County that are
on the federal list of endangered species or are listed as
"of concern." This list was verifed with the regional
office of the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Department. Each plant or
animal is listed by its common name, followed by its scientific
name and a letter indicating its status on the federal list.
(Following the list is a key to the
status symbols.)

- California red-legged frog (Rana aurora draytonii ) T
- California tiger salamander (Ambystoma californiense) C
- Santa Cruz long-toed salamander (Ambystoma macrodactylum
croceum) E
- Bald eagle (Haliaeetus leucocephalus) T
- Brown Pelican (Pelecanus occidentalis) E
- California Clapper Rail (Rallus longirostris
obsoletus) E
- Marbled murrelet (Brachyramphus marmoratus) T, CH
- Western snowy plover (Charadrius alexandrinus nivosus) T, CH
- Yellow-billed Cuckoo (Coccyzus americanus) C
- Tidewater goby (Eucyclogobius newberryi) E, CH
- Smith's blue butterfly (Euphilotes enoptes
smithi) E
- Mt. Hermon June beetle (Polyphylla barbata) E
- Ohlone Tiger Beetle (Cicindela ohlone) E
- Zayante band-winged grasshopper (Trimerotropis
infantilis) E, CH
- Southern sea otter (Enhydra lutris nereis) T
- Ben Lomond spineflower (Chorizanthe pungens var.
hartwegiana) E
- Ben Lomond wallflower also called Santa Cruz wallflower (Erysimum teretifolium) E
- Monterey spineflower (Chorizanthe pungens var. pungens) T
- Robust spineflower (Chorizanthe robusta var. robusta) E
- Santa Cruz cypress (Cupressus abramsiana ) E
- Santa Cruz tarplant (Holocarpha macradenia) T
- Scotts Valley polygonum (Polygonum hickmanii) [Species of Concern]
- Scotts Valley spineflower (Chorizanthe robusta var
hartwegii) E
- Tidestrom's lupine (Clover Lupine) (Lupinus tidestromii) E
- White-rayed pentachaeta (Pentachaeta bellidiflora)
E
- San Francisco garter snake (Thamnophis sirtalis
tetraenia) E
- E = Endangered
- T = Threatened
- CH = Critical Habitat
- PE = Taxa proposed for listing as endangered
- PT = Taxa proposed for listing as threatened
- PCH = Critical habitat which has been proposed
- C = Candidate species for which the Fish and Wildlife Service
has on file sufficient information on the biological
vulnerability and threats to support proposals to list as
endangered or threatened
